It is a S N 2 reaction.
C 2 H 5 O – attract the proton from phenol converting the later into phenoxide ion. This would then make nucleophilic attack on the methylene carbon of alkyl iodide, but C 2 H 5 O – is in excess C 2 H 5 O – is better nucleophile than C 6 H 5 O – (phenoxide) ion since while in the former the negative charge is localised over oxygen and in the later it is delocalised over the whole molecular frame work. So, C 2 H 5 O – ion make nucleophilic attack at ethyl iodide to give diethyl ether (Williamson’s Synthesis).
